Waratahs on pastel silk handpainted by Jane Hinde. The Waratah is the state emblem for NSW, Australia and the iconic symbol for Craft NSW. This is a hand painted silk scarf using acid-based dyes making it fast to light and washing.

Size: 28 x 160 cm long silk scarf

Care: Handwash in warm water and iron whilst damp.
